WebCircular Linked List Data Structures Using C Tutorials Table of contents A circular linked list is a type of linked list in which the last node is also connected to the first node to form a circle. Thus a circular linked list has no end. Circular Linked List Data Structure There are two types of linked lists: Circular Singly Linked List.
